Manufacturer (American, 1855 - 1921)
Datec. 1900
Mediumcut glass
Dimensions18 x 7 inches (45.7 x 17.8 cm)
Credit LineGift of Nelda C. Stark, 1981
Object number41.54.1
ClassificationsHousehold Accessories
DescriptionCircular base; cylindrical shape with waisted neck; flared rim with sawtooth scalloped rim; Monarch pattern.
ProvenanceW.H. Stark [1851-1936] and Miriam Lutcher Stark [Mrs. W.H. Stark, 1859-1936][1]; by inheritance to their son H.J. Lutcher Stark [1887-1965]; by inheritance to his wife Nelda C. Stark [1909-1999]; gifted March 5, 1981 to the Nelda C. and H.J. Lutcher Stark Foundation; accessioned to The W.H. Stark House | 1. Visible in the historic photographs of the Stark House
